The term higher-order functions refers to functions that either take functions as arguments or return functions. The functions we used to create closures in the previous chapter are thus higher-order functions. Higher-order functions are frequently used in R instead of looping control structures, and we will cover how you can do this in general in the next chapter. I will just give you a quick example here before moving on to more interesting things we can do with functions working on functions.
